Output 33caae15107287936efcedcaf024588285d93d64ab1c3f5e66470ab45bc77730:45

value
342215
script pubkey
OP_0 OP_PUSHBYTES_20 df7418e2838e340143d411241e938d91377fe059
address
bc1qma6p3c5r3c6qzs75zyjpayudjymhlcze2ltt7u
transaction
33caae15107287936efcedcaf024588285d93d64ab1c3f5e66470ab45bc77730
spent
true